Cymbal Cases for Whip Storage/Transport

Post by Texas Raider »

For those of you looking for a good case for your whips, especially traveling by air, where you have to check your baggage, a cymbal case works as a great whip case! I used these style cases when I was a road musician to carry my drums and gear. Many choices and HARD SHELL cases for air travel, not to mention padded dividers to separate whips. This is what I've used for a long time, thought I'd share. Here are a few examples-
